Loss Prevention Market Manager

Barnes & Noble, Inc. is seeking a Loss Prevention Market Manager to ensure a safe and secure environment across assigned stores. The LPMM will collaborate with store teams to implement inventory shrink initiatives, analyze data related to theft, and lead a team of market investigators.

Retail

Responsibilities

Manage and ensure all physical security standards are in place and communicate any risk exposures to Home Office Loss Prevention partners
During in-store and/or virtual visits, actively walk the sales floor to identify merchandise protection opportunities and to ensure the sales floor is safe and free from hazards. If needed, coach bookselling team in the moment regarding these areas
Manage the execution and ongoing maintenance of the shrink reduction and LP awareness programs and measure results
Investigate and help resolve inventory integrity issues by working with business partners for appropriate resolution
Manage data analytics for your assigned stores by regularly analyzing and reviewing trends and providing recommendations to prevent future incidents
Assess compliance with Loss Prevention programs and identify areas of potential risk and gaps between actual performance and company standards
Advise and manage all Loss Prevention issues by partnering with field management to determine impact, resolution and preventive measures on all shrink and quality of life issues
Tailor and manage Loss Prevention programs for the market and train, educate and motivate store teams on safety, shrinkage reduction and all other loss prevention procedures
Develop excellent market investigators, providing them with motivation, feedback, development and realistic goals that align with the needs of the stores
Write and review incident summaries and investigative reports that are timely, concise and accurate
Respectively, manage internal and external investigations, including apprehending shoplifters and interviewing employees
Ensure that the Loss Prevention programs align/support our five bookstore principles (i.e., Presentation, Commerciality, Section Detail, Localization & Sense of Theater)
Manage the preparation, execution and reconciliation of the physical inventory process and provide oversight and guidance to respective stores
Manage all health and safety issues by partnering appropriately and escalating when needed
Use remote working technology (Teams, Outlook 365, etc.) and select travel to support the above
